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ving, navigate to Trnava by following the D1 highway. Once in Trnava, use GPS or a map application to reach Radlinského street. Bernolák’s gate is located at Radlinského, 917 01 Trnava. There is limited street parking available nearby, so be prepared to park in designated zones (check for any parking fees).

  • Public Transportation

    To reach Bernolák’s gate using public transportation, you can take a train to Trnava from major cities such as Bratislava. Upon arrival at Trnava train station, exit the station and look for bus or tram stops nearby. You can take bus number 1 or 2 towards the city center. Get off at the 'Trnava, Mlyn' stop. From there, it's a short walk to Radlinského street where Bernolák’s gate is located. Make sure to check for the latest bus or tram schedules and any ticket costs.

  • Walking

    If you are already in the vicinity of Trnava city center, you can walk to Bernolák’s gate. Starting from the main square (Hlavné námestie), head towards Radlinského street. The gate is approximately a 10-minute walk from the square. Follow signs or ask locals for directions if needed.

Discover more about Bernolák’s gate

Bernolák’s Gate, a prominent historical landmark in Trnava, Slovakia, stands as a testament to the city's rich architectural heritage and vibrant past. Originally part of the city’s fortifications, this impressive structure dates back to the 14th century and was named after the notable Slovak linguist Anton Bernolák. Visitors to the gate can admire its stunning Gothic design, characterized by intricate stonework and towering arches that convey the grandeur of medieval architecture. As you stroll through the surrounding area, you'll find a blend of old-world charm and modern-day life, making it a perfect spot for photography and leisurely exploration. The gate is not just a remarkable piece of history; it also serves as a gateway to understanding Trnava's evolution over the centuries.
